If you have any questions not addressed on the websites, please reach out to your child\u2019s teacher after school begins, or contact our office staff:<\/span><\/p><ul><li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Principal:<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">David Thornley at dthornley@fusdk12.net<\/span><\/li><li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Secretary:<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Amanda Crabtree at acrabtree@fusdk12.net<\/span><\/li><li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Office Assistant:<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Nancy Saldivar Ureno at nsaldivarureno@fusdk12.net<\/span><\/li><\/ul><p><a href=\"https:\/\/fremontunified.org\/cabrillo\/about\/staff-directory\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cabrillo Staff Directory 2023-2024<\/span><\/a><\/p><p><a href=\"https:\/\/drive.google.com\/file\/d\/1R4DczVRBfH1TG90R3Py-H9phOLK-1j8N\/view\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cabrillo Elementary Bell Schedule 2023-2024<\/span><\/a><\/p><br \/><p><b>Cabrillo School Site Council (SSC) 2023-2024 Openings &#8211; We Need Four Volunteers:<\/b><\/p><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cabrillo needs four volunteers to the SSC representing the community. <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Please apply by clicking the linked text <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/docs.google.com\/forms\/d\/e\/1FAIpQLSeKIi8IeAxiUxvVWr2H0KhUPLMQeV8PRgrvWca2fFK1ENA4Yw\/viewform?usp=sf_link\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">School Site Council (SSC) Interest Survey 23-24<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> or going to <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/bit.ly\/3Yy0z71\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">https:\/\/bit.ly\/3Yy0z71<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The purpose of the School Site Council (SSC) is to oversee the school programs that include the curriculum and best instructional practices. SSC is made up of the principal, parents and teachers, and ensures that the needs of every Cabrillo student are met. The SSC monitors the Single Plan for Student Achievement (SPSA) Plan (see below). This group also oversees the spending of certain funds provided through LCAP (see below).<\/span><\/p><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">SSC is made up of an equal number of parents and staff. Parents are elected by parents, and staff are elected by the staff. These members represent the entire school community.<\/span><\/p><p><b>LCAP: Local Control Accountability Plan:<\/b><\/p><ul><li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This is the plan developed to ensure continuous improvement of our school.
